Teen Gym

Teen Gym sessions enable children from the age of 11 years to use the fitness studio in a safe, supervised environment, under the guidance of qualified fitness Instructors. There will always be one instructor present, but may be two, depending upon numbers attending. Sessions are for one hour and need to be booked at reception as spaces are limited. The fitness studio remains open to the general public at these times. Visit the homepage for your choice of leisure centre to view the relevant fitness studio timetable.

Teen Gym sessions are at set times and cost £3.50 per session for non members. Children are encouraged to follow balanced programmes using a variety of equipment including the resistance machines and cardio vascular equipment. It would not be advisable, for instance to just spend the hour using the weights.

How to Join Teen Gym

Prior to using the fitness studio, participants must attend a Teen Gym Induction session, bookable at reception. During the induction, children learn all they need to know about using the equipment safely and effectively, as well as the importance of effectively warming up and cooling down. They may also have the chance to have a go on the equipment. The induction session costs £3.50, lasts for about an hour and is a very important introduction to using the fitness equipment.

Before the induction session, a health questionnaire must be completed which needs to be signed by a parent or legal guardian. It is essential that the instructor is made aware of any health conditions that may affect the child, and in serious cases, consent may be required from the Doctor before the child can attend.

On completion of the induction session the child will receive a Teen Gym Gym registration Zest Card. This can be used to book the sessions. Booking is strongly advised as spaces are limited and we don't like to turn people away!

Personalised Programmes

Personalised programmes can be written and we would strongly recommend this so that the most benefit is obtained from attending the sessions. Just ask the instructor at the first session and this will be organised for you.

It is then possible for the child to attend the fitness studio with a parent or legal guardian if it is more convenient than attending the set times for Teen Gym. The parent will need to attend their own fitness induction session if they are not already an authorised Fitness Studio User. They will need to sign a declaration that they are fully responsible for their child during their time in the studio and will need to attend every time the young person comes in, unless they attend the organised Teen Gym Sessions.

Membership Options

Become a Junior Lifestyle member and not only is teen gym included, but teen classes (where available), junior group swimming lessons, public swimming practice and other selected courses, as programmed for members.

Alternatively, juniors under 16 are registered free of charge for level 2 pricing for all activities, for which an Easy Zest card is issued. They can then book for activities and enjoy the level 2 pricing for all pay and play activities until their 16th birthday. If attending Teen Gym, the Easy Zest card is validated for the Teen Gym sessions.

After the age of 16 years, level 2 pricing can be available if remaining in full time education. Registration then becomes £5.00 and proof of eligibility is required. Visit the memberships section and read about pay and play discounts for full details.
